Well contrary to popular beliefs, pageants are a lot more than beauty. The following were the steps/ things we did in the pageants:

- Popularity vote: A website you have to share with people from your country and the higher votes you have, it shows the higher support you have from your country therefore meaning you are out there and your people like you.

- Boot camp: You are given scores over a boot camp that lasts about 1 week mostly focused on behaviour and how nice you are to your peers and the children younger than you, how you take care of them and how you generally conduct yourself with peers.

Q&A: A question and answer where they ask you questions like why shoudl we chose you and how would you be different. or they ask you about the different countries you will be representing to show you have good knowledge of the place you will be representing.

- Talent night: A night where you present your talent to people. It can be anything you like wether it is dancing, poetry, singing or anything else. I personally focused on a poem about not feeling enough and raising awareness for people who are in a dark place and want to harm themselves. I put a lot of emotion and it touched a lot of people in the audience, some where even crying.

- Cultural attire: A fashion walk where you showcase an outfit that represents the culture of the country you are representing. You give a speech about it and an homage to your country and their people.

-Introduction speech: A speech where you talk about yourself, your hobbies and basically introduce yourself to the audience. You also talk about your work and previous charity endeavours you have done and how you have helped the people in your country. I personally started a foundation about a year before that focusing on teaching the poorer kids that are not able to afford daily livings dexterous skills that they could use to create some little income and even develop their talents.

- Pageant walk: The main walk you give in your evening gown before you give your final speech. You need to be graceful and have a good walk too.

Main speech: The speech you give in your evening gown where you talk about what you would do if you where to win and how you would help the people around you in the region you are representing. Personally, I talked about growing my foundation and working with other countries in the region. Furthermore, collaborating with other pageant queens who may not have placed on the top so that their ideas and voice may also be heard. I talked about being a leader to the other queens and helping the continent in general.

So overall, through those different things, thee judges then come and make a decision based off those stuff. I believe that the main speech and the impact you would do during your year of reign was worth about 70% of your total marks showing that beauty pageants are not all beauty. The beauty part comes in during the actual pageants or events you have to attend but during your year of reign, the things you do are the ones that matter the most. This is a big misconception that people have about pageants but they are genuinely great platforms to be able to do charity work and especially as a pageant queen and winner, you are able to use the platform to make more of a difference in the people you are trying to support as news channels do interwievs with you and you can call on different brands/ organisations to help you out.
